RoleAssignmentX 要素 (DeploymentManifest)RoleAssignmentX Element (DeploymentManifest)

に適用されます: SharePoint 2016 |SharePoint Foundation 2013 |SharePoint オンライン |SharePoint Server 2013Applies to: SharePoint 2016 | SharePoint Foundation 2013 | SharePoint Online | SharePoint Server 2013

基本オブジェクトの増分変更を展開中の場合のセキュリティ ロール割り当てを表します。Represents a security role assignment in cases where incremental changes to the base object are being deployed.

DefinitionDefinition

DECLARATION
<xs:element name="RoleAssignmentX" type="DeploymentRoleAssignmentX" />

USAGE
<SPObject>
        <RoleAssignmentX
                Operation="SecurityModificationType"
                OperationCode="xs:string"
                ScopeId="xs:string"
                RoleDefWebId="xs:string"
                RoleDefWebUrl="xs:string"
                ObjectId="xs:string"
                ObjectType="xs:string"
                ObjectUrl="xs:string"
                AnonymousPermMask="xs:string"
                RoleName="xs:string"
                RoleId="xs:string"
                GroupTitle="xs:string"
                UserLogin="xs:string"
        />
</SPObject>

Type

DeploymentRoleAssignmentX( SPRoleAssignment をに基づいて)DeploymentRoleAssignmentX (based on SPRoleAssignment)

要素と属性Elements and attributes

以下のセクションで、属性、子要素、親要素について説明します。The following sections describe attributes, child elements, and parent elements.

属性Attributes

属性Attribute Type 説明Description
OperationOperation
SecurityModificationType 単純型 (DeploymentManifest)SecurityModificationType Simple Type (DeploymentManifest)
必須。許可するセキュリティ ロールの変更の種類を指定する列挙型。Required. Enumeration type that specifies which security role modifications are allowed.
OperationCodeOperationCode
xs:stringxs:string
必須。Required.
ScopeIdScopeId
xs:stringxs:string
必須。ロールの範囲をリスト レベルまたは Web レベルのどちらにするかを指定します。Required. Specifies whether the scope of the role is list level or Web level.
RoleDefWebIdRoleDefWebId
xs:stringxs:string
必須。ロールにロール定義を適用する Web の識別子。Required. Identifier of the Web whose role definition applies to the role.
RoleDefWebUrlRoleDefWebUrl
xs:stringxs:string
必須。ロールにロール定義を適用する Web の URL。Required. URL of the Web whose role definition applies to the role.
ObjectIdObjectId
xs:stringxs:string
必須。ロール割り当てオブジェクトの識別子。Required. Identifier of the role assignment object.
ObjectTypeObjectType
xs:stringxs:string
必須。ロール割り当てオブジェクトの型。Required. Type of the role assignment object.
ObjectUrlObjectUrl
xs:stringxs:string
必須。ロール割り当てオブジェクトの URL。Required. URL to the role assignment object.
AnonymousPermMaskAnonymousPermMask
xs:stringxs:string
オプション。匿名ユーザーの許可マスク。Optional. Permission mask for anonymous users.
役割名RoleName
xs:stringxs:string
オプション。割り当てに関連付けられたセキュリティ ロールの名前。Optional. Name of the security role associated with the assignment.
RoleIdRoleId
xs:stringxs:string
オプション。セキュリティ ロールの識別子。Optional. Identifier of the security role.
GroupTitleGroupTitle
xs:stringxs:string
オプション。ロールに関連付けられたセキュリティ グループの表示名。Optional. Display name of the security group that is associated with the role.
UserLoginUserLogin
xs:stringxs:string
オプション。ロールに関連付けられたユーザーのログオン資格情報。Optional. Logon credential for users associated with the role.

子要素Child elements

なしNone

親要素Parent elements

SPObject 要素 (DeploymentManifest)SPObject Element (DeploymentManifest)

関連項目See also